{"id":45356,"count":1,"description":"Angelus Oaks is an unincorporated town in San Bernardino County, California, USA, and has a population of 289. It is located north of Mentone, California on State Highway 38. Its downtown consists of a general store (currently closed), a restaurant, a post office (zip code 92305), a real estate office, and a United States Forest Service office. Within town are two commercial lodges for overnight visitors. Originally Camp Angelus was served only by the National Forest Service; now Angelus Oaks is served by the San Bernardino County Fire Department Station 98 and two private water companies. The original school was a log cabin on a hill located behind and rented from Glen Lodge. The lodge had a full restaurant, bar, gas and repair station, grocery store, hotel, cabins, and a dance hall with a large fireplace. In 1953 the first teacher, originally from South Dakota and a graduate of USC, was Orville Young.
